Gov’s Wife Distributes Gift Items, Cash To hospitals, old people’s home in Ebonyi
By Joyce Onuora, Abakaliki
The Wife of the Ebonyi State Governor, Mrs Mary-Maudline Uzoamaka Ogbonna Nwifuru has paid an unscheduled visit to hospitals while also distributed gift items and cash to the visited old people’s home and Hospitals in the state.
The Governor’s wife was received on arrival at the hospitals by matrons at the various facilities visited and, was ushered to the post delivery wards of the healthcare facilities where she reached out to nursing mothers and their babies with financial support and gifts.
She commenced the visit at Society of St. Vincent de Paul Old People and Destitutte homes, St Patrick Hospital Mile Four, St. Theresa’s hospital and maternity and Iboko izzi general hospital.
The Governor’s wife who embarked on the visitation in company of top women government officials, congratulated the new mothers who were visibly elated to see her and distributed bags of rice, garri, foams, buckets and baby items to the indigent people.
Mrs Nwifuru said that the essence of the exercise was motivated out of love and appreciation to the group and to let them know she will continue to support them
She also said that the distribution of the gift items was to give succour to the downtrodden in the society.
In his vote of thanks, Mr Lekpa John, Caretaker and inmate of the Old peoples homes, thanked Mrs Nwifuru for magnanimity and commitment to their wellbeing and welfare at all times.
Also, nursing mothers, Mrs Esther Nwali and Ogechi Kingsley, appreciated the wife of the governor for the gifts, applauding her fights against gender based violence and other social vices affecting women and children in the state.
